  • Abstract
    In this paper we propose a novel method of estimating vanishing point by spherical gradient. In contrast with the conventional methods in which vanishing point is estimated from lines, the proposed method does not necessarily extract lines, but employs the spherical gradient cues of edge points. Based on the observation that spherical gradient is aligned with the normal vector of the projection plane of space lines, the vanishing point is estimated directly from spherical gradient of edge points by the Hough Transform.
